According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 9 reports of Peripheral swelling have been filed in association with DROSPIRENONE (Angeliq). This represents 0.3% of all adverse event reports for DROSPIRENONE.

How Dangerous Is Peripheral swelling From DROSPIRENONE?
Of the 9 reports, 4 (44.4%) required hospitalization, and 1 (11.1%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Peripheral swelling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for DROSPIRENONE. However, 9 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
